Let be a closed Riemannian manifold with positive sectional curvature. Let denote the smallest prime divisor of , and let an -torus act effectively and isometrically on . Sharp cyclicity conjecture. If
then is cyclic. This conjecture would give a sharp obstruction to non-cyclic fundamental groups under a sufficiently large torus symmetry rank; the bound is motivated by spherical space-form examples, which show that the corresponding threshold cannot generally be lowered.
